I use a PB superflash out back on blink. The batteries last pretty much forever in blink mode. In front I have a dual halogen nightsun. 10 watts one side, 35 on the other. When riding in the dark I use both. Holy crap is it bright! I use a boat anchor SLA battery I mount on my rack. It is about 7 pounds. It will power the nightsun easily for 3 or 4 round trips which is about 6 hours run time. It might go quite a bit longer, but, deep cycling an SLA battery is a good way to kill it.
It is now sufficiently light enough to take this battery off which ought to make my hillclimbs a lot quicker.
So, if you don't mind the extra pounds, go with a big arse SLA battery and a halogen light.